The furkids and I had a weekend FULL of fun and jam packed with stellar results!

Fabian ran clean but over time...don't care anymore. He'll be 12 next month and I'm just thrilled he can play!

Greta had a Greta weekend...slow starts but ran ok once we started. One wipeout in a tunnel I wasn't thrilled with but it didn't seem to bother her. No Qs but 3 fun runs.


Zak had 10 runs...8 Qs! One Elite Chances Q which all alone made the weekend awesome! :clap: The 2 NQs...one was totally me. The other was in Chances where we had an oops before coming back to do it great! Huge progress with Lil' Man!! He's taking his "out" very literally these days which fortunately I realized and found great humor in!

REO stole the weekend! 8 runs, 7 Qs! A perfect 4 for 4 on Sunday! I have decided 4 runs/day is a bit much for him just now so we'll go back to 3/day for a while. REO's highlights:
-Weaved in public (and earned his first Q in Regular)
-Weaved in public (after a few tries in Nov Chances, NQ but we got 'er done!) :D
-Q in Novice Chances
-Qs and titles in Novice Jumpers, Tunnelers AND Touch N Go! :1st:
